From the pulpits and street corners of Ardmore, OK comes Bryan Marcel Williams I aka Marcel P. Black (the emcee).
Once a member of a underground hip hop collective, Black ventured out into solo territories and has been on a steady mission
to revolutionize the way you think of, listen to and view hip hop music. Though inspired by multiple musical genres and great emcees, Black's greatest influence as a hip hop artist can be found within himself. An ever evolving entity, Marcel P. Black at one time or another has been a misguided soul influenced by gang culture, an athlete, a band geek, a militant and a mentor but at all times has been authentically a man, authentically him.
From the hole-in-the wall Oklahoma nightclubs to the posh, upscale martini bars of Southern Louisiana emerges Bryan Marcel Williams I as DJ Hard Work. DJ Hard Work evolved out of necessity. Bryan Marcel Williams was tired of spending hard-earned money to go out partying just to hear the same thing in the club that is constantly on the radio. DJ Hard Work evolved because someone had to be the voice (or the hands) of the hip hop lovers, the remix heads, the B-side people, those who value the quality of music over the status, affluence or wealth of the artists making it. DJ Hard Work is a connoisseur, listener and student of good music, particularly good hip hop music and it is for this reason he is quickly becoming a favorable name in the Baton Rouge community.

After their 2008 Tour, Red Ink moved to Los Angeles and focused on expanding their West Coast fan base. Playing stages like 'The Airliner', 'The Whisky' and 'The Good Hurt' they caught the attention of critics and music fans alike. Some of L.A.'s most popular music journals praised the band's live energy and debut recording, 'The E.P.'. In-Studio Performances with IS Good Music and KXLU helped share the band's unique blend of Soul and Rock with the rest of the country. The band is currently writing new material for their next release as well as collaborating with other L.A. artists.

LevelLs was raised in Brooklyn, New York. He developed his passion for music early in life and he knew that it was going to be a priority, not an option. He decided to continue the tradition of music through the generations in his family. Always playing music as a youth, He took a strong love to the drums and piano. His first production was at 9 yrs old on the first piece of equipment that he recalls producing on, a DX-7 synthesizer and a Yamaha drum machine. LevelLs was always known for music in high school. In those years, He was a part of a 4-piece band called I.D.E.A. where he played the drums and they would play for local events.

LevelLs went on to study Music Engineering in college and left early to focus on his music career. He started working with other musicians in the New York tri-state as well as other states to expand his market for music production. He evolved relentlessly and pushed forward to create a style of music that is influenced by 80’s Pop, Classical to Hip-Hop and combining them into new sounds. His music influences are broad and very vast, even drawing inspiration from some of his favorite comedians such as, Chris Rock and Bernie Mac. "A good comedian always has good relevance to life, and that is what I put in my music.

"LevelLs is currently branding his own independent venture. He is currently working on his debut album, “The Resume” due out spring 2011. His debut single, “Hip-Hop” already has a good buzz through the internet which is his ode for the love of the culture. With his smooth, slick wordplay, he's bringing a reminisce back of Hip-Hop’s 90's Golden Era with a current style that will continue the tradition of Hip-Hop for years to come.
